Pan-Seared Mackerel with Lemon Herb Sauce

A simple yet flavorful pan-seared mackerel dish topped with a fresh lemon herb sauce that enhances the rich taste of the fish. Perfect for a quick and healthy main course.

Main Dish
Easy 20 min 320 cal
Steps

1. Pat the mackerel fillet dry and season both sides with salt and black pepper. 2. Heat ol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. 3. Place the mackerel skin-side down and cook for 3-4 minutes until the skin is crispy. 4. Flip the fillet carefully and cook for another 2-3 minutes until the fish is cooked through. 5. In a small bowl, mix garlic, parsley, lemon juice, lemon zest, capers, and melted butter to create the lemon herb sauce. 6. Remove the fish from the skillet and plate it. 7. Spoon the lemon herb sauce over the cooked mackerel and serve immediately.

Ingredients

1 whole mackerel fillet (about 150g) 1 tbsp olive oil Salt and black pepper to taste 1 garlic clove, minced 1 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ice 1 tsp lemon zest 1 tsp capers (optional) 1/2 tbsp butter
